• Episode 146: Five Dry Runs, One Lifesaving call: Tony's Transplant Triumph
    Nov 3 2025
    In this powerful Kidney Warrior Story, host Dee sits down with Tony to unpack a decade-spanning journey through chronic kidney disease (CKD)—from a shock Stage 4 diagnosis of IgA Nephropathy (IgAN) to Stage 5 kidney failure, peritoneal dialysis (PD) with brutal drain pain, a transition to haemodialysis (HD), line infection and coma, the courage to self-needle with a fistula, and ultimately the life-changing gift of a kidney transplant. Tony shares the practical and emotional realities few hear about: choosing PD vs HD, APD (overnight machine) vs manual gravity bags, buttonhole vs rope-ladder needling, home haemodialysis training, fluid management, and rebuilding confidence after hospital trauma. He explains how movement and sport (from 5K Parkruns to half marathons) helped his mental health on dialysis—and how he kept going after FIVE “dry-run” transplant calls before finally receiving his match. Post-transplant, Tony competed at the Transplant Games (bronze in cycling!), then faced a sudden cycling accident with a broken talus—and still came back stronger with kidney function over 90%. Tony’s message? You’re not alone. With support, information, and small, consistent steps, more is possible than you think.   • Episode 143: Organ Donation Week: Why Your Choice Matters (UK)
    Sep 22 2025
    This powerful episode of Diary of a Kidney Warrior Podcast reunites host Dee with Lucy, a Specialist Nurse in Organ Donation (SNOD), for a frank, myth-busting conversation about deceased organ donation in the UK. Four years after their first chat, Lucy returns to unpack what’s changed since England moved to an opt-out system (May 2020), why families still have the final say, and how your conversation today can save lives tomorrow. Dee & Lucy explore the realities behind Organ Donation Week, clarify the law and clinical safeguards (brain stem death and circulatory death), confront common misconceptions (like “doctors won’t try to save me” or “they weren’t really dead”), and spotlight the human impact—for grieving families and transplant recipients alike. You’ll also hear practical, compassionate ways to start the donation conversation at home, how to nominate a key representative on the NHS Organ Donor Register, and why every single “yes” matters when only ~1% of deaths happen in circumstances suitable for organ donation—amid 8,000+ people waiting and only ~1,400 donors last year. In this episode, you’ll learn: •What the opt-out law really means (and doesn’t): when it applies, why family consent is still required, and how to record an explicit opt-in. •How death is confirmed in the UK: independent teams, strict tests, and legal definitions (brain stem death & circulatory death). •The role of your family: why registered + discussed decisions lead to consent ~98% of the time—and how to make your wishes crystal clear. •Practical scripts & starters for talking about donation (from TV moments to family gatherings) and why even a short note/letter can help. •Benefits for families: meaning, comfort, and legacy during grief—plus how follow-up info (anonymised) can support healing. •Benefits for recipients: life-changing freedom from organ failure and dialysis—alongside a realistic look at immunosuppression. •Equity matters: why people from Black and Asian communities often wait longer, and how community champions and faith leaders can move the needle. •Suitability myths busted: age, past illness, blood-donation rules ≠ organ-donation rules—register and let clinicians assess. •Action steps for Organ Donation Week: register, nominate a key representative, talk to your loved ones, and share your decision.   • Episode 142: Breaking the Silence: Menopause and Kidney Disease
    Sep 8 2025
    In Episode 142 of Diary of a Kidney Warrior Podcast, host Dee Moore sits down with Dr. Vikram Talaulikar—menopause specialist and Associate Professor in Women’s Health—to demystify menopause for people living with chronic kidney disease (CKD). If you’ve ever wondered whether changing periods, brain fog, poor sleep, hot flushes, joint aches or low mood are “just stress,” menopause, or CKD—this conversation is for you. We explore the menopause transition (perimenopause → menopause → postmenopause), how symptoms can overlap with CKD, and what practical steps you can take right now. You’ll hear about: •Perimenopause vs. menopause—what’s normal, what to track, and why one blood test often doesn’t tell the full story. •Lifestyle strategies that genuinely help (sleep hygiene, movement, nutrition, supplements to discuss with your team). •Non-hormonal options (including CBT and certain medications) and when they may be considered. •HRT in CKD—safer formulations, delivery routes, and the “lowest effective dose” principle to discuss with your clinicians. •Bone and heart health during and after the transition—and what to raise at your next appointment. •Why timely support matters and how to build a joined-up plan with your GP, kidney team, or menopause specialist.   • Episode 141: Beyond the GP: Making Primary Care Work for Kidney Health, Part 2
    Aug 25 2025
    How do you know when your kidney health needs more than GP care—and how can you make sure you’re getting the right tests, referrals, and treatment? In this powerful follow-up to Episode 139, host Dee Moore is once again joined by Dr. Kristin Veighey for Part 2 of “Beyond the GP: Making Primary Care Work for Kidney Health.” Together, they dive deeper into the realities of managing chronic kidney disease (CKD) in the primary care setting, giving patients the tools to advocate for themselves and get the support they need. This episode answers the questions so many patients ask but rarely get clear guidance on: ✅ Know your risk factors – from diabetes, high blood pressure, and heart disease to family history and medications that can affect kidney function. ✅ Why urine tests matter – and why they often reveal problems years before blood tests. ✅ Diabetes and CKD – the number one cause of kidney disease in the UK, and why tighter blood pressure, cholesterol, and glucose targets are essential. ✅ When to push for referral – understanding the Kidney Failure Risk Equation (KFRE), what “CKD stage 4 or 5” really means, and why you don’t have to wait until dialysis is on the table. ✅ The role of the multidisciplinary team – how pharmacists, nurses, and other professionals in primary care can help streamline your care and reduce unnecessary appointments. ✅ Targets that protect your kidneys – the real numbers you should be aiming for with blood pressure, cholesterol, and blood sugar. 🎯 Whether you’re newly diagnosed or already living with CKD, this episode gives you actionable strategies to protect your kidneys, prevent decline, and get the care you deserve. Dr. Veighey also stresses the importance of knowing your numbers, asking the right questions, and never accepting “it’s fine” without evidence. This is about empowerment, early detection, and personalised care—because the earlier CKD is recognised, the better your long-term outcomes. 🔑 Key Takeaway: Your kidneys can’t wait.
